From: Linus Torvalds Date: Fri, 15 Jan 2021 21:11:51 +0000 (-0800) Subject: Merge tag 'arm64-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/arm64/linux X-Git-Tag: v5.15~1979 X-Git-Url: http://review.tizen.org/git/?a=commitdiff_plain;h=82821be8a2e14bdf359be577400be88b2f1eb8a7;p=platform%2Fkernel%2Flinux-starfive.git Merge tag 'arm64-fixes' of git://git./linux/kernel/git/arm64/linux Pull arm64 fixes from Catalin Marinas: - Set the minimum GCC version to 5.1 for arm64 due to earlier compiler bugs. - Make atomic helpers __always_inline to avoid a section mismatch when compiling with clang. - Fix the CMA and crashkernel reservations to use ZONE_DMA (remove the arm64_dma32_phys_limit variable, no longer needed with a dynamic ZONE_DMA sizing in 5.11). - Remove redundant IRQ flag tracing that was leaving lockdep inconsistent with the hardware state. - Revert perf events based hard lockup detector that was causing smp_processor_id() to be called in preemptible context. - Some trivial cleanups - spelling fix, renaming S_FRAME_SIZE to PT_REGS_SIZE, function prototypes added. * tag 'arm64-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/arm64/linux: arm64: selftests: Fix spelling of 'Mismatch' arm64: syscall: include prototype for EL0 SVC functions compiler.h: Raise minimum version of GCC to 5.1 for arm64 arm64: make atomic helpers __always_inline arm64: rename S_FRAME_SIZE to PT_REGS_SIZE Revert "arm64: Enable perf events based hard lockup detector" arm64: entry: remove redundant IRQ flag tracing arm64: Remove arm64_dma32_phys_limit and its uses --- 82821be8a2e14bdf359be577400be88b2f1eb8a7
